Minister of Aviation and Aerospace Development, Festus Keyamo, has said he would not totally pull down the aviation roadmap implemented by the immediate past administration.
However he hinted about tinkering with the roadmap by adding to it.
The Aviation roadmap unveiled by his immediate past predecessor, Senator Hadi Sirika, encompasses various projects like the national carrier, airport concession, the establishment of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ul (MRO) facility, among others.

Rihanna has reportedly welcomed her second child with her 34-year-old partner A$AP Rocky
The 35-year-old singer gave birth to a son on August 3 in Los Angeles, TMZ claimed on Monday. She has yet to comment on the report, however, the outlet added that though they do not yet know the name of her bundle of joy, they do know that the first name begins with an ‘R.’
The singers already have a son named RZA Athelston who was born in May 2022.

Former Kaduna State Governor, Nasir El-Rufai, has warned the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) to halt its planned military intervention in Niger Republic.
Stating the reason why the West African regional bloc should tread with caution, El-Rufai said the African nationals are brothers, and war in any of the countries will be injurious to all.
El-Rufai made this known via a post on X, formerly Twitter, stressing that Nigerien nationals and Nigerian people in the North are one.
The ex-governor made this warning following a statement by ECOWAS defence chiefs that they would not have any choice but to use force against Niger.

The Medical and Dental Consultants Association of Nigeria (MDCAN) has issued a 21-day ultimatum to the federal government to implement the upward review of the Consolidated Medical Salary Structure (CONMESS) and other demands.
In a communique issued on Monday after its National Executive Council meeting, the association said it could “no longer guarantee the present relative industrial harmony within the public hospitals and our medical schools if the issues were not satisfactorily resolved.”
